Nginx忽略favicon.ico日志

来自Linux78|wiki
Bob讨论 | 贡献2020年3月13日 (五) 16:07的版本
(差异) ←上一版本 | 最后版本 (差异) | 下一版本→ (差异)

favicon.ico占用nginx error_log日志大量信息,把以下配置放到 server {} 块,关闭favicon.ico不存在时记录日志

location = /favicon.ico {
log_not_found off;
access_log off;
}

//log_not_found on|off,默认为on:启用或禁用404错误日志,这个指令可以用来禁止nginx记录找不到rebots.txt或favicon.ico这类文件的错误信息。

log_not_found on|off,默认为on:启用或禁用404等错误日志

第二种 做一个favicon.ico文件,上传到站点跟目录下,或者在href这个位置写favicon.ico文件网络路径,然后添加到站点文件内,代码如下(其实多数情况不加下面代码也可以,为了兼容性更好还是加吧)

<link rel="shortcut icon" href="/favicon.ico" type="image/x-icon" />